The Supply Chain and Strategic Sourcing Group at Facebook is seeking a Global Supply Manager for various disciplines (Cameras, sensing, and or Optics) to drive impact and deliver results in highly innovative Meta devices. This position will focus on leading one of the most strategic categories in sourcing.

The scope includes identifying, selecting and developing new partnerships for new products and new technologies through early engagement across cross functional partners, aligning external partner strategy to internal product roadmap needs, and to deliver best in class technologies and experiences, accessibly. An ideal candidate will have high ambition to grow with Meta. You must be a high impact individual with a demonstrated ability to succeed in a high-demand and fast-paced environment. Demonstrated ability to successfully navigate through ambiguities/difficult obstacles through facts & data, evaluation of alternatives, open-mindedness, thought-through strategy, and superior communications to lead cross-functional organizations through sourcing activities will be required.

GSM: Global Supply Manager Responsibilities

  • Actively engage and influence new technology exploration, collaborate with cross functional partners on creating a long term Technology Roadmap mapping closely with Product Roadmaps, and advise/recommend to the executive team a clear partner/supplier strategy

Own tech transfer into suppliers and elevating supplier's technology capabilities

Work with engineering teams to engineer manufacturing and process technology solutions that best aligns with our technology partners

Develop and drive technology partner engagement strategy ensuring suppliers are capable of meeting Facebook's current and future technical and business requirements

Support and influence HWD engineering team in new technology scoping effort with potential partners

Continually benchmark the industry to monitor technology trends and ensure best practices are incorporated into the Meta supply chain

Ownership of sourcing category and strategies, leading 5+ year technology portfolio decisions, partner selection and business negotiations

Partner and work with a cross-functional team to drive the supplier selection process (own RFx) and component qualification both under strict engineering and commercial best practices/disciplines

Actively participate in aiding to solve technical challenges along with cross-functional partners

Ability to perform Value Engineering second source qualification, alternate materials/process evaluation/quality, and other cost reduction initiative at the material/manufacturing level

Be an expert in commodity technology, cost and supply. Strong command of value engineering and technical cost reduction concepts to both product and category level

Drive Early Supplier Involvement initiatives to ensure our suppliers are proactively providing input into new product designs and future product roadmaps

Ability to be creative on drafting development deals to kick start new relationships, and also to preserve a long term view to establish best-in-class pricing, flexibility, quality, delivery, payment, warranty, and service terms

Drive product cost and negotiate competitive pricing while keeping in mind the total cost of ownership including product cost, CapEx, logistics, inventory and cost of quality

Apply cost engineering principle to deliver most aggressive should-cost and budget (OpEx/CapEx) projections, with the ability to stand up to the most aggressive alternatives, doubts, and scrutiny

Formulate contingency plans to de-risk technical challenges, long lead time, single source, and any supply risks

Drive supplier and site readiness activities for NTI and NPI programs leading to successful product launch with the ability to deliver to the required volumes at launch. This includes coverage across operational, commercial and legal domains

Accountability for securing components and/or services in the above category that will provide competitive advantage in both technology and cost for Facebook

Achieve established commitments on total cost results, supply, quality and compliance adherence, and on-time delivery

Ability to travel internationally

About Meta

Meta builds technologies that help people connect, find communities, and grow businesses. When Facebook launched in 2004, it changed the way people connect.

Apps like Messenger, Instagram and WhatsApp further empowered billions around the world. Now, Meta is moving beyond 2D screens toward immersive experiences like augmented and virtual reality to help build the next evolution in social technology.
